What reviewers say
Higganum Veterinary Clinic is widely recognized for its exceptionally compassionate, knowledgeable, and thorough veterinary team. The staff, including reception and technical support, consistently provides a welcoming and supportive environment for patients and their families, particularly during end-of-life care and routine visits. While the vast majority of visitors highlight fair pricing, warm interactions, and great accommodations for various animal types, occasional scheduling hurdles and communication gaps have been noted during periods of staff transitions.
